(CNN) — The Supreme Court on Monday turned away President Donald Trump’s longshot effort to deny a $5.6 million payment he was ordered to make three years after a jury found he sexually abused and defamed the former magazine writer E. Jean Carroll.
The court’s decision is the latest legal loss for Trump in his protracted legal fight with Carroll. Though the Supreme Court had already denied the president’s appeal in June, Trump’s attorneys had asked the court to reconsider that decision, which the justices have now declined to do.
There were no noted dissents.
Under a lower court order, Trump had already paid Carroll the $5.6 million. Carroll’s lawyers said in a court filing that she would “place the award in an interest-bearing account until Defendant’s petition for rehearing is denied.”
Carroll sued Trump in 2019 for defamation, and then she sued him again in 2022 for defamation and battery after New York enacted a law allowing victims of sexual abuse to file civil claims for past incidents. The second case — the one filed in 2022 — went to trial first and the jury awarded Carroll $5 million.
The 2019 case went to trial next and resulted in an $83 million judgment against Trump. Though the court’s decision Monday is the last stop for the president in this case, the separate $83 million case is now pending at the Supreme Court.
The high court rarely grants rehearing requests.
